I have some trouble when our customer getting an image from html because their connection is so slow, and cannot load the image on html they think that our app has bug on it. So is there any future update for having html image loading so they know that the image is being loaded.

@rymesaint I do know that some image loading can be slow, however, this may not be a defect of flutter_html, rather a large image or a poor internet connection.
Currently, there is a PR open that should allow you to choose an image provider, and if I end up liking it and finding it is good to go, you may be able to download the images ahead of time, so that your html can render it locally.
If this is entirely a poor connection or a large image issue, I recommend that you compress the image so that it will decrease the load time.
If none of this applies, please reply with an example of an image that is being slow, along with the expected behavior, and I'll see what I can do.
We are now showing a loading spinner when the image is loading. More advanced loading states can be added later, if still there is a need for it, after #505 has been merged.
